NEW DELHI — US sanctions on Russian military exports have put the brakes on a $6 billion deal with India and may derail the arms purchases of other US allies around Asia, experts say. [1]

YANGON—Myanmar sign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) early this week with India to appoint a private operator for Sittwe Port. The move is part of the Kaladan Multi Model Transit Transport Project under India’s ambitious Act East Policy. [2]

Permanent Secretary Jukka Juusti to visit India Permanent Secretary Jukka Juusti from the Ministry of Defence will make a working visit to New Delhi, India on 13 to 17 January 2020. [3]

WASHINGTON — The United States and India on Wednesday agreed to strengthen security and civil nuclear cooperation, including building six U.S. nuclear power plants in India, the two countries said in a joint statement. [4]
